#ifdef CONFIG_TMPFS_POSIX_ACL
/**
* Superblocks without xattr inode operations will get security.* xattr
* support from the VFS "for free". As soon as we have any other xattrs
* like ACLs, we also need to implement the security.* handlers at
* filesystem level, though.
*/
static size_t shmem_xattr_security_list(struct inode *inode, char *list,
size_t list_len, const char *name,
size_t name_len)
{
return security_inode_listsecurity(inode, list, list_len);
}
static int shmem_xattr_security_get(struct inode *inode, const char *name,
void *buffer, size_t size)
{
if (strcmp(name, "") == 0)
return -EINVAL;
return security_inode_getsecurity(inode, name, buffer, size,
-EOPNOTSUPP);
}
static int shmem_xattr_security_set(struct inode *inode, const char *name,
const void *value, size_t size, int flags)
{
if (strcmp(name, "") == 0)
return -EINVAL;
return security_inode_setsecurity(inode, name, value, size, flags);
}
struct xattr_handler shmem_xattr_security_handler = {
.prefix = XATTR_SECURITY_PREFIX,
.list = shmem_xattr_security_list,
.get = shmem_xattr_security_get,
.set = shmem_xattr_security_set,
};
static struct xattr_handler *shmem_xattr_handlers[] = {
&shmem_xattr_acl_access_handler,
&shmem_xattr_acl_default_handler,
&shmem_xattr_security_handler,
NULL
};
#endif
